2. | James Taylor, II (1.James1) was born on 14 Mar 1673 in New Kent County, Virginia; died on 23 Jan 1729 in Greenfield, Orange Co., Virginia; was buried in 1729 in Taylor Cem, Rapidan, Orange Co, VA. Other Events and Attributes:
Notes: Col. Taylor was Colonel of Militia of King and Queen Co., Va. He was a member of "The Knights of the Golden Horse Shoe," under Gov. Spottswood's Expedition. He was Surveyor General of the Colony of Va.; Burgess, King and Queen Co., 1702-14; Justice of the Peace. He died at "Bloomsbury," Orange Co., Va., at the home which he built in 1720, on an estate of ten thousand acres. It is about four miles from Orange courthouse, and the house, which is still standing, is in good condition. James married Martha Thompson on 23 Dec 1699 in Orange County, Virginia. Martha (daughter of Colonel William Thompson and Martha Montague) was born in 1679 in Carlisle, Cumberland, England, U.K.; was christened in Blackwell Neck, Hanover, VA; died on 19 Nov 1762 in Greenfield, Orange, VA; was buried on 19 Nov 1762 in Taylor Cem, Rapidan, Orange Co, VA.
